The Cardea Center’s activities support our vision of a world without barriers, fulfilling the CCW’s motto of “Opening doors to opportunity, Enriching lives through education, support and outreach; Empowering women by valuing their voices, leadership and contributions”.
The Cardea Center achieves this by engaging the whole community on behalf of women as a way to catalyze positive change. Our approach is to reinforce rather than replicate the efforts of local women's organizations. We build strategic alliances with service providers, community-based organizations and other key stakeholders to connect women of all ages and serve as a comprehensive clearinghouse for community resources and information. We also organize and partner on a number of women’s initiatives and events that align with our vision and mission.
The center focuses on four main areas of interrelated issues covering a wide array of activities, designed to increase the opportunities for women.
A ‘Hub’ For Women’s Activities: Create a resource and networking center (initially virtual and ultimately physical) for women and women’s organizations with adequate space and physical characteristics to facilitate trainings, workshops, forums, etc.
Work And Economic Advancement:Provide opportunities for career and professional growth, including micro-enterprise development and access to resources to improve women’s economic advancement and security.
Personal Development And Public Engagement:Support women’s personal development encouraging self-discovery. Encourage their civic participation in both the public and private sectors in their communities; assist women to pursue their leadership aspirations and build skills for effective advocacy.
Advocacy and Public Policy:Increase awareness and dialogue about current policies and legislation affecting the welfare of women and girls at regional, national and global arenas. Offer critical perspectives on women’s concerns and issues, as well as opportunities to connect with and support national and international efforts.
